Subject: Handover — Snapshot testing DB for Pluglet authors

Taking over from Marek's rotation. Plugin authors: snapshot baselines for UI components now live in the shared snapshots database, not the repo. Stale baselines older than 90 days get purged Sundays. Run the Pluglet CLI against the store before publishing; mismatches block release. Read access for external authors uses the connection string below.

primary connection of yagep-kahip = redis://giliel_svc:zYiKsLL2PLpfPL@db-348f.xolmarsys.corp:5432/fenwyn

## Authentication

All shard-routing calls in ProfileMesh are authenticated against the internal directory service before any partition lookup occurs. Requests lacking a valid credential are rejected prior to shard resolution, preventing enumeration of partition topology. Keys are rotated quarterly and scoped read-only for the router tier. The current reviewer-scoped key follows.

gateway credential: kto3_qfe

Subject: Transport of replacement lock — Keldway branch safe

Hello dispatch,

Please arrange same-day transport for the replacement lock mechanism for the Keldway branch safe. The unit is packed in a sealed, tamper-evident box, approximately two kilograms, and is stored at the secure cage pending collection. It must travel alone in the lockable compartment of the vehicle, with no intermediate stops logged on the run. The driver's coordinator should brief the courier in person before departure. The hand-over instruction is as follows.

drop instructions, yafog-yawip: the quenmir olidor courier leaves the julox tamion keliel ledger at gate 5283 under passcode 336825